Abstract
The tumultuous history of Bucovina has put its mark on the destiny of those born in this land of contrasts. An example in this sense is the life and activity of Dragos Vitencu, one of the exponents of the Romanian culture in Bukovina during the interwar period. Formed in Bucovina's intellectual environment in the first half of the 20th century, Dragos Vitencu is considered by friends "a model in all". The one who had been the leader of the student life in Chernivtsi would have to accept a new social order in which other principles functioned than those he had acquired in the interwar period of Chernivtsi. The nostalgia of these times is present in the novel Letters from God, which was edited only in 2012, 21 years after the death of the author.
